Australia Enacts New Crypto Exchange Regulations, Boosting Market Flexibility

Australia has introduced a new regulatory bill for crypto exchanges, aiming to unlock significant economic benefits while enhancing consumer protection. This landmark legislation, expected to generate $24 billion in annual productivity gains, will create a framework for licensed operators seeking compliance with stringent standards set by the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C). The bill will also exempt smaller companies from full licensing under specific conditions, ensuring market access and protecting client interests.
